概括
人们甚至在实验室外也表现出公平的规范. 在博物馆的终极游戏 (UG) 中,参与者拒绝了不公平的报价,并使用提议者历史来告知决策,展示了现实世界的不平等厌恶.

背景情况:
- 对公平的经验理解往往依赖于具有有限概括性的实验室研究.
- 公平性研究的生态有效性受到同质样本的挑战.
研究的目的:
- 在现实世界,生态有效的环境中调查公平性规范.
- 通过公民科学方法,检查最后通游戏 (UG) 中的决策.
- 探索提议者历史对公平判断的影响.
主要方法:
- 在13个月的时间里,在一个博物馆设置中嵌入了最后通游戏 (UG).
- 从异质的公众样本中收集了 >18,672 个决定.
- 包括一个选项,让参与者在决定之前查看提议者历史.
主要成果:
- 复制了UG的经典发现:不公平的报价经常被拒绝,证实了不平等的厌恶.
- 大多数参与者使用了提议者历史信息.
- 信息采样提高了对公平性违规行为的敏感性,特别是来自以前慷慨的提案者的信息采样.
结论:
- 公平的规范和不平等的厌恶超越了实验室环境.
- 寻找有关过去行为的信息显著影响公平性判断.
- 实验室实地方法为研究真实的决策提供了一个可扩展的模型.

Surveys
16.6K
Often, psychologists develop surveys as a means of gathering data. Surveys are lists of questions to be answered by research participants, and can be delivered as paper-and-pencil questionnaires, administered electronically, or conducted verbally. Generally, the survey itself can be completed in a short time, and the ease of administering a survey makes it easy to collect data from a large number of people.
